What changed here
DerivedJanata Dal held the seat; the winning margin narrowed from 25.8% to 8.1%.
- Won on a lower shareIts own vote share fell 9.6% — it held because the rest of the vote was more divided.
- New challengerBharatiya Janata Party (BJP) finished second with 34.2% — it did not contest here in 1989.
